A major Public Sector organisation is seeking an experienced Strategic Relationship Manager to lead high-level partnerships across complex construction and commercial programmes. This is a senior, strategically focused role requiring exceptional stakeholder management, commercial awareness, and the ability to operate confidently across government and industry environments.
You’ll act as a trusted advisor and relationship lead, working across senior leadership teams, suppliers, delivery partners and government stakeholders to strengthen strategic partnerships, improve outcomes, and support long‑term programme delivery.
The Role- Lead and manage strategic relationships across complex construction and commercial environments
- Influence senior stakeholders across government, supply chain and partner organisations
- Drive collaborative working, governance and long‑term partnership performance
- Identify risks, opportunities and delivery challenges proactively
- Translate complex information into clear strategic insight for decision‑makers
- Support commercial and delivery objectives within large‑scale infrastructure or construction programmes
- Operate autonomously within a high‑profile, outcome‑focused environment
- Proven experience in Strategic Relationship Management, senior stakeholder engagement or partnership leadership roles
- Strong construction sector and commercial experience, including knowledge of supply chains and delivery environments
- Experience working within or alongside government/public sector organisations
- Strong understanding of governance, assurance and accountability frameworks
- Excellent influencing and communication skills with credibility at senior/executive level
- Ability to manage competing priorities across complex stakeholder landscapes
- Commercially astute, proactive and solutions‑focused
- NEC contract knowledge highly desirable
This opportunity would suit a Senior Commercial professional who thrives in complex environments and can build trusted partnerships that drive delivery at scale.
